Railfan Spots
10 curated locations. All approved by moderators — user-suggested spots wait in the queue until reviewed.
Barstow — Harvey House / BNSF Yard
station · Barstow, CA
Safety: goodBNSFAmtrakBest: Morning for east-facing platform shots; the mainline runs east-west, so afternoon light works for westbound trains.
Cajon Pass — Sullivan's Curve overlook
overlook · San Bernardino, CA
Safety: cautionBNSFUnion PacificBest: Morning light favors westbound (downhill) trains; afternoon/evening light favors eastbound climbers and is the classic photo angle.
Donner Summit — Old US 40 / Soda Springs
overlook · Soda Springs, CA
Safety: cautionUnion PacificBest: Late morning best for eastbound (downhill) trains heading toward Truckee; sunset on the snowsheds is iconic.
Fullerton Transportation Center
station · Fullerton, CA
Safety: goodBNSFAmtrakMetrolinkBest: Late afternoon for west-facing platform shots; morning for east-facing. Both sides of the platform face the tracks.
Niles Canyon — Sunol viewing area
park · Sunol, CA
Safety: goodNiles Canyon RailwayUnion PacificBest: Mid-morning best — the canyon orientation favors east-facing shots.
Riverside — Downtown Metrolink station + BNSF
station · Riverside, CA
Safety: goodBNSFUnion PacificMetrolinkBest: Morning best for east-facing platform shots; the BNSF main runs roughly E-W through Riverside.
Roseville — J.R. Davis Yard area
yard-view · Roseville, CA
Safety: restricted_nearbyUnion PacificBest: Morning for east-facing yard views; the yard runs 24/7 so any time has movement.
San Bernardino — Cajon Junction view
overlook · San Bernardino, CA
Safety: cautionBNSFUnion PacificBest: Mid-morning to early afternoon — sun lights the climbing trains beautifully against the red sandstone.
Santa Susana Pass — Stoney Point Park
park · Chatsworth, CA
Safety: cautionUnion PacificMetrolinkAmtrakBest: Late afternoon — west-facing trackage catches golden hour light. Morning sun is behind the trains.
Tehachapi Loop overlook
overlook · Tehachapi, CA
Safety: goodUnion PacificBNSFBest: Late morning to mid-afternoon — the loop faces south so the sun is on the train regardless of direction.